Key responsibilities for the role: Ensuring workspaces and public areas remain clean and tidy throughout and after service. Carrying out cleaning duties as needed, always following Health & Safety and COSHH guidelines. Operating and maintaining the plate wash and pot wash machines, including daily cleaning. Assisting with stock rotation and safely storing food in line with Health & Safety regulations. Using cleaning chemicals when required, while following PPE and safety guidelines. Casual work is a great solution as it enables you to work flexibly around other commitments in your life. Once you have registered your interest, we will contact you in advance to offer you department based shifts at racedays or hospitality functions. There are usually a range of shifts available and opportunities for work are based on busy seasons and the annual racing calendar. Positions will be allocated on the day as part of the briefing.
